"景先生毕设|www.jxszl.com

stm32的车载环境监测报警装置设计【字数:13447】

2022-12-01 20:46编辑: www.jxszl.com景先生毕设
近年来随着我国汽车市场全面开放,国民经济日益增长,家用汽车价格逐步下滑,汽车从10年前的奢侈品已渐渐成为寻常百姓出行必备品。随着家用汽车的普及,各种车内安全保障系统也渐渐受到人们重视。据了解,如果车内二氧化碳浓度达到500PPM时就会使身体感到不舒适,进一步产生伤害,如若二氧化碳浓度进一步上升,当其达到800PPM时就可以直接造成死亡。低浓度的二氧化碳能够促进人体的呼吸,使中枢神经兴奋。而现今的车内二氧化碳浓度因其无色无味的特点使其不能被人们所精确把控,仅仅通过人体感受来控制车内二氧化碳浓度的高低显然是不够的。为解决这一问题,本文设计了一种以STM32单片机为基础的车载环境监测报警装置。此装置能够在单片机的控制下通过CO2传感器等多种传感器采集到的例如CO2浓度、温度、车速等信息,对车内环境进行判断,最终决定车窗的开启状态、车内空调的开启状态以及是否开启报警闪光灯等,以此来调节车内空气的CO2浓度、空气湿度以及温度,使车内环境最终达到最佳状态。该系统反应灵敏,报警装置十分可靠,且无论是体积、成本还是调节模式都具有极强的市场竞争力,方便实用,是一种新型的、十分贴近人们生活的安全防护系统。
Key words: environmental monitoring;automatic regulation;STM32 single chip computer 目录
1. 绪论 1
1.1 课题设计的主要背景及意义 1
1.2 课题设计的主要内容 2
1.3 章节安排 2
1.4 本章小结 3
2. 总体方案设计 4
2.1 系统的总体结构 4
2.2 系统设计原则 4
2.3 主要模块的选用方案和论证 6
2.3.1 主控制器模块 6
2.3.2 CO2传感器模块 6
2.3.3 温度传感器模块 8
2.3.4 显示模块 8
2.4 本章小结 9
3. 车载环境监测系统硬件电路分析 11
3.1 二氧化碳传感器模块 11
3.2 温度传感器模块 12
3.2.1 温度传感器模块硬件组成 12
3.2.2 *51今日免费论文网|www.jxszl.com +Q: ¥351916072¥ 
温度传感器模块的使用及结果处理 13
3.3 OLED显示模块 14
3.3.1 OLED模块简介 14
3.3.2 OLED模块硬件组成 15
3.3.3 OLED基本原理 15
3.4 本章小结 17
4. 系统软件设计 18
4.1 系统主程序设计 18
4.2 CO2传感器模块 19
4.3 OLED显示模块 21
4.4 DHT11模块 22
4.5 本章小结 23
5. 系统实现与测试 25
5.1 传感器的安装与环境检测 25
5.2 温度传感器程序调试与实测 26
5.3 CO2传感器程序调试与实测 27
5.3.1 二氧化碳模块校准 27
5.3.2 二氧化碳模块程序调试与实测 28
5.4 本章小结 30
总结 31
参考文献 33
致谢 34
附录 35
绪论
近年来中国经济取得巨大进步,人民生活水平日益提高,汽车逐渐进入寻常百姓家,成为人们出行的必备产品,车载安全保障装置也随着汽车的逐渐普及渐渐收到人们的重视。而传统汽车车内环境由于技术的限制只能由车内乘员经验判断诸如温度、湿度等信息,无法对CO2浓度等信息进行精确把控,对乘车安全性产生了巨大威胁。由此催生了一种能够精确识别车内环境状态并且进行准确调节的车载环境报警装置。
课题设计的主要背景及意义
随着国民经济的快速增长,人们普遍开始追求高质量的生活,各种现代化产品逐渐从奢侈品转化为日用必需品。汽车作为18世纪80年代的产物,经历了100多年的发展,逐渐被人们所发掘、完善,现已完全走入寻常百姓的生活之中。而近年来中国经济的腾飞更是给了汽车行业一个巨大的发展契机,巨大的国内市场吸引着无数汽车供应商投入到此浪潮之中。而现代化的汽车要想占据更多的市场份额,光在价格、外观、质量等方面努力是远远不够的。现代人更多追求的还是其安全性、舒适性,在这一基础之上,汽车制造商纷纷将目光投入到各种基于驾乘体验而设计出的舒适性、安全性系统之上。
出于安全性考虑,我们将目光投向了车内空气质量监测这一模块。我们知道,二氧化碳在一般情况之下并不具有毒性,而根据研究表明,低浓度的二氧化碳有助于人体的呼吸作用,能够促进人类的呼吸循环系统。而高浓度的二氧化碳则会对人体产生一定程度上的危害,百分之八至百分之十浓度的二氧化碳甚至能够在短时间内使动物的肌体产生缺氧窒息,进而使动物或人体直接死亡。根据pr En 13779标准,室内最大的CO2浓度推荐值是800ppm[1]。而汽车内部作为一个半封闭式的空间,更需要人们关注其空气内的二氧化碳含量,以便提升汽车的安全性能。二氧化碳作为一种无色无味的气体存在于我们周围的空气中,光凭感觉上对其进行浓度上的判断是不够、并且不准确的,况且一旦人们感到不舒适的时候,二氧化碳的浓度实际上已经过高,并且可能已经对人体产生了一定程度上的危害了。此情况在停车休息的时候可能更加危险,驾驶员经过几个小时的驾驶十分疲劳,睡着之后可能即使身体产生不适,也不会立即苏醒,此种情况必然会对人身安全产生极大的威胁。精确快速检测二氧化碳的浓度, 成为一个大家关注的问题[1]。
由此我们思考是否能够设计出一种装置能够即时显示当前状态下的空气内二氧化碳浓度、空气湿度、温度,并且能够主动对一定范围内的空气质量进行调节,对驾驶员及其乘客发出警报,以此来保护乘员安全。在这一基础上我们设计出了一种基于STM32的车载环境监测报警系统,此装置旨在解决上述车内空气质量改变而未被乘员意识到进而引发乘员伤亡的问题。
课题设计的主要内容
本车载环境监测报警装置针对目前汽车使用过程中产生的空气质量安全性问题,在现有STM32单片机发展基础上,结合各类传感器对当前空气质量进行综合评判,并作出相应处理。首先是各类传感器诸如CO2传感器、车速传感器、温度传感器采集到当前的车内CO2浓度信号、车速信息、温度信息,将其传递给主控芯片,同时通过OLED模块显示出当前状态下的CO2浓度、温度以及湿度,主控芯片通过给定的控制逻辑判断当前状态下是否需要开启通风、空调以及车窗,再由OLED模块显示出装置当前所执行的操作。
章节安排
第一章:本章主要介绍了本设计的初衷以及所解决的“车内环境质量无法精确判断”的问题,并对整个设计的主要架构做出解释。
第二章:本章主要对设计的总体方案以及车载环境监测系统的工作方式以及原理做出论述,并针对所用到的CO2传感器模块、温度传感器模块、显示模块的选型做出论证。
第三章:本章对车载监控系统的主要硬件诸如二氧化碳传感器、DHT11温湿度传感器以及OLED显示模块的主要工作原理做出论述,对各传感器的外观以及控制方式做出展示。

原文链接:http://www.jxszl.com/jxgc/qcgc/83799.html